The Optimist Vithas Trophy, born in Vigo with the intention of being a reference

Ramón Ojea (Commodore CM Vigo), Dr. Ciro Cabezas (Vithas), Mauro Olmedo (President CM Canido), Catalina Lamas (Vithas) and Emilio Méndez (Director of Regata) (Photo Pedro Seoane)
The Club Marítimo de Canido and the Hospital Vithas Vigo have presented this morning the Trophy Vithas Vigo, which in its first edition includes the experience of the 24 Spring Regatas organized even by the Maritime. This makes the next weekend 90 optimist of all Galicia can be gathered in a test that aspires to become a reference within the light candle at the peninsular level. Among the confirmed participants, the presence of the full Galicia Selection, which will take advantage of this meeting to complete its preparation for the Spanish Cup that is held in the coming days in the Gipuzcoan city of Hondarribia.
On the other hand, and from now on, the School of Sailing of the Maritime Club of Canido will become the School of Selling Vithas Vigo. In this school, a hundred students take their first steps in the sailing world every year. In addition, every summer, it hosts another 150 students, who do not have to belong to the Maritime Club to receive their "sea baptism."

The area where the race field will be set up is the area known as the Canido Tenada which is at the socaire of the archipelago of the Cis Islands.
On line exit by La Coruña the number one in the Galician ranking, which won in the week Abanca the Regata Aurelio Fernández Laxe: Fernando González del Castillo. On the part of Ribeira, the strongest a priori is Bruno Iglesias, which is the number two Galician. Both optimists still have two seasons in the optimist, and they have a splendid future ahead of them.
For the host club, the best positions are Rodrigo Pérez Moya, Fernando Campos and Miguel Rodríguez Tábara... as well as Emma Chamorro.
The Royal Nautical Club of Sanxenxo presents, in line of departure, its best female choice, which is Natalia Domínguez, and in Pedro Casas boys.
At the technical level, the Maritime has two of the best judges and jurors in Galicia, that with the case of the vilagardean Juan José Durán and the vigués the young Carlos Mugra, which is the maximum promise as a bravery of the College of Judges and Jurors of Galicia.
The Royal Nautical Club of Vigo has its hopes set in Inés Ameneiro and Jorge Astiazarán. The clubs confirmed today are the Monte Real Club de Yates de Baiona, the Nautico de Panxón, the Marítimo de Canido, the Real Nautico de Vigo (which will be, with 25, the club with the most athletes), Real Club Nautico Rodeira de Cangas, Real Club Nautico de Sanxxo, Club Nautico Deportivo de Ribeira, Club Fluvial de as Pontes, Club Nautico de Sada, Club Marítimo de Oza and the Real Club Nautico de A Coruña.
